Tech Roles You Could Aim For

Real industry tech roles your 3D132 background maps to — picked from BLS-anchored occupations using your training, cognitive skills, and systems experience.

Network Engineer

Infrastructure

SOC 15-1241
High match

Your experience deploying, sustaining, troubleshooting, and repairing network infrastructure systems directly translates to the responsibilities of a Network Engineer. You have hands-on experience with network design, configuration, operation, defense, and restoration. Your familiarity with systems like Promina 400/800 (MPLS) and Network Management Systems (NMS) aligns well with the tools and technologies used in this role. Your experience with network security protocols is also directly applicable.

Typical stack:

TCP/IP fundamentalsRouting protocols (BGP, OSPF)Firewall and VPN configurationCloud networkingCisco or Juniper hands-on

Security Engineer

Security

SOC 15-1212
Good match

Your background in cryptographic equipment operation and maintenance, along with your knowledge of network security protocols and procedures, provides a strong foundation for a Security Engineer role. Your experience with secure terminal equipment (STE) and KG-175D TACLANE appliances demonstrates familiarity with encryption technologies relevant to security engineering. Your understanding of communications security programs, including physical, cryptographic, transmission, and emission security, is highly valuable.

Typical stack:

Networking and OS internalsCryptography fundamentalsThreat modelingCloud security (IAM, VPC)Code review for security

Hidden Strengths

Cognitive skills your 3D132 training built — and where they transfer.

System Modeling

This role requires creating and understanding complex network architectures, including voice, data, and video systems, and cryptographic components. You visualize how different parts interact to ensure seamless communication.

You can quickly grasp the interconnectedness of complex systems, predict how changes in one area will affect others, and troubleshoot problems efficiently.

Rapid Prioritization

When network outages occur, you must quickly assess the impact, identify the most critical systems, and allocate resources to restore them first, ensuring vital communications remain operational.

You excel at quickly determining the urgency and importance of tasks, especially under pressure. You can triage situations, allocate resources effectively, and focus on what matters most.

Degraded-Mode Operations

You maintain functionality even when systems are partially damaged or compromised. This includes finding alternative communication paths or using backup equipment to keep operations running.

You are resourceful and adaptable in challenging situations. You can develop workarounds, maintain essential functions under stress, and ensure business continuity despite setbacks.

Procedural Compliance

You adhere to strict technical orders, safety regulations, and communications security protocols. Following these procedures is critical for maintaining secure and reliable network operations.

You understand the importance of following established guidelines and regulations. You are detail-oriented and committed to maintaining standards, ensuring quality, and avoiding errors.

Situational Awareness

You must constantly monitor network performance, anticipate potential issues, and quickly respond to anomalies. You need to understand the overall operational environment to make informed decisions.

You are highly observant and can quickly assess your surroundings. You anticipate problems, react proactively to changing conditions, and make sound judgments based on the available information.

Non-Obvious Career Matches

Robotics Technician

SOC 49-9062.00

You've been maintaining complex network infrastructure and troubleshooting technical issues. As a Robotics Technician, you'll use those same skills to repair and maintain automated systems. Your experience with diagnostic software and test equipment translates directly to this field.

Industrial Control Systems Security Specialist

SOC 15-1299.09

You've been responsible for the security of critical communication systems. In this role, you will be securing industrial control systems (ICS) and operational technology (OT) environments from cyber threats. Your background in cryptography and network defense makes you an ideal candidate.

Building Automation Systems Technician

SOC 49-9012.00

You've managed and maintained voice, data, and video networks. Building automation systems integrate these same technologies to control lighting, HVAC, and security. Your ability to troubleshoot and maintain complex systems is directly applicable.

Geospatial Intelligence Analyst

SOC 15-1199.03

You've developed strong situational awareness skills through monitoring network performance and responding to anomalies. As an analyst, you would leverage geospatial data to identify patterns, predict events, and advise decision-makers. Your analytical mindset and experience working with complex systems will make you successful.

Training & Education Equivalencies

Cyber Transport Systems Technical Training, Sheppard AFB, TX

990 training hours25 weeksUp to 15 semester hours recommended

Topics Covered

  • Network Infrastructure Installation and Maintenance
  • Voice, Data, and Video Network Troubleshooting
  • Cryptographic Equipment Operation and Maintenance
  • Network Security Protocols and Procedures
  • Agile Logistics and Supply Chain Management
  • Diagnostic Software and Testing Equipment
  • Network Performance Monitoring and Analysis

Certification Pathways

Partial Coverage

CompTIA Network+70% covered

Study advanced networking concepts, routing protocols, and network security best practices.

CompTIA Security+60% covered

Focus on risk management, cryptography, access control, and security assessments.

Cisco Certified Network Associate (CCNA)50% covered

Deepen knowledge of Cisco networking equipment, configuration, and troubleshooting.

Technical Systems Translation

Military systems you've used and their civilian equivalents for your resume.

Military SystemCivilian Equivalent
Integrated Communications Access Package (ICAP)Enterprise network access control systems (e.g., Cisco ISE, Forescout)
Promina 400/800Multiprotocol Label Switching (MPLS) network infrastructure
Secure Terminal Equipment (STE)Encrypted VoIP phone systems (e.g., Cisco Unified Communications with encryption)
KG-175D TACLANEHigh-assurance IPsec VPN encryption appliances (e.g., General Dynamics, Thales)
Network Management System (NMS)Network monitoring platforms (e.g., SolarWinds, PRTG, Nagios)
Time Division Multiplexing (TDM) systemsLegacy telecommunications infrastructure
Outside Plant (OSP) cablingUnderground and aerial fiber optic and copper cabling infrastructure
